引言
随着计算机视觉技术的不断发展,双目视觉和对接视觉作为其中重要的分支,在多个领域展现出巨大的应用潜力。本文将深入探讨双目视觉与对接视觉的技术差异,以及它们在实际应用中的表现和优势。
双目视觉
定义与原理
双目视觉是一种通过模拟人类视觉系统来感知三维空间的技术。它利用两个摄像头同时捕捉同一场景,通过比较左右眼视图的差异,计算出物体的距离、深度等信息。
技术特点
- 立体视觉:双目视觉能够生成立体图像,提供丰富的三维信息。
- 距离测量:通过视差计算,可以准确测量物体与摄像头之间的距离。
- 适应性:适用于多种光照条件和场景。
应用领域
- 机器人导航:双目视觉可以帮助机器人进行环境感知和避障。
- 自动驾驶:双目视觉在自动驾驶系统中用于识别车道线和行人。
- 虚拟现实:双目视觉可以为虚拟现实提供更真实的视觉体验。
对接视觉
定义与原理
对接视觉是一种通过匹配两个摄像头拍摄的图像来实现场景重建的技术。它通过分析图像之间的对应关系,重建出三维场景。
技术特点
- 场景重建:对接视觉可以重建出高精度的三维场景。
- 适应性:适用于复杂场景和动态环境。
- 实时性:对接视觉可以实时处理图像,提高系统响应速度。
应用领域
- 增强现实:对接视觉可以为增强现实提供更丰富的视觉信息。
- 建筑测量:对接视觉可以用于建筑物的三维测量和重建。
- 工业检测:对接视觉在工业领域用于检测产品质量。
技术差异
成像原理
- 双目视觉:利用两个摄像头同时捕捉同一场景,通过视差计算实现三维感知。
- 对接视觉:通过匹配两个摄像头拍摄的图像,实现场景重建。
应用场景
- 双目视觉:适用于需要立体视觉和距离测量的场景。
- 对接视觉:适用于需要场景重建和三维信息提取的场景。
实际应用
机器人导航
- 双目视觉:通过双目视觉,机器人可以感知周围环境,实现自主导航。
- 对接视觉:对接视觉可以用于构建机器人周围环境的3D模型,提高导航精度。
自动驾驶
- 双目视觉:双目视觉可以用于识别车道线和行人,提高自动驾驶的安全性。
- 对接视觉:对接视觉可以用于构建道路和交通标志的3D模型,提高自动驾驶的可靠性。
增强现实
- 双目视觉:双目视觉可以提供更真实的立体视觉效果,增强用户体验。
- 对接视觉:对接视觉可以用于实时重建周围环境,为增强现实应用提供更丰富的场景信息。
总结
双目视觉和对接视觉是计算机视觉领域重要的分支,它们在实际应用中各有优势。了解两者之间的技术差异和实际应用,有助于我们更好地选择和应用这些技术。随着技术的不断发展,双目视觉和对接视觉将在更多领域发挥重要作用。
